both-way communication
In the process of communication, we must pay attention to intonation, tone and body language, such as smiling, listening and nodding to show acceptance. We can also ask some questions to improve our understanding.
Avoid direct accusations.
When a child makes a mistake, try to avoid direct blame, but tell the child how he feels. In addition, the attitude towards children's unreasonable troubles must be firm and gentle and firm.
Opportunities to provide services
At home, it is necessary to give children the opportunity to provide services, make them feel valuable, and give them the opportunity to be masters of their own affairs, which can enhance their self-identity.
one's words match his deeds
In the process of children's growth, parents' words and deeds have a far-reaching impact on children. Parents' words and deeds are role models for children to imitate learning, so parents should be as good as them and be cautious.
